How to cook deliciously - Pelmeni
1. Stage
In the large bowl of a stand mixer fitted with the dough hook, beat flour, egg, and salt on medium speed until a shaggy dough forms. Pour in water and continue to beat until dough comes together. Continue to beat until dough is smooth and pliable, about 5 minutes. Wrap dough in plastic wrap and let rest 15 to 30 minutes.
2. Stage
Divide dough into 2 pieces. On a lightly floured surface, roll dough to 1/16" to 1/8" thick. Using a 2 1/2" round cutter, cut out about 50 rounds. Arrange on a floured surface and cover with plastic wrap. Let rest until ready to use.
3. Stage
Line a baking sheet with parchment. Dust parchment with flour. In a large bowl, mix beef, onion, and salt to combine.
4. Stage
Place 1 teaspoon filling in the center of each round. Fold rounds into half moons and pinch edges to close. Pull ends together and pinch to seal (they should almost look like tortellini). Repeat with remaining filling and dough. Arrange pelmeni on prepared sheet.
5. Stage
Bring a large pot of salted water to a bare simmer. Working in batches, drop in pelmeni and cook until they float to the top, 3 to 4 minutes (it helps to take one out and test to see if they’re tender or al dente). Using a slotted spoon, transfer pelmeni to a large bowl. Toss in butter to coat.
6. Stage
Divide pelmeni among plates. Sprinkle with dill. Serve with sour cream alongside.
